1. The Role of a Criminal Defense Lawyer:
Throughout your first examination, your lawyer will certainly discuss their function in the legal process. They will certainly review how they will certainly advocate for your rights, examine your case, and build a strong protection method in your place. This is a crucial opportunity for you to comprehend the lawyer's technique and determine if they are the right suitable for your case.

3. Analysis of Proof:
Your lawyer will certainly examine any type of proof that has existed versus you. This might include cops reports, witness declarations, forensic proof, or monitoring video footage. They will examine the proof to identify its importance and possible impact on your case.

4. Defense Approaches and Lawful Choices:
Based on the information you offer and the evidence assessed, your attorney will discuss possible defense strategies and lawful choices. They will clarify the staminas and weaknesses of each technique and assist you comprehend the possible end results. This is a possibility for you to ask inquiries and gain a clear understanding of your protection technique moving on.

5. Fee Structure and Lawful Expenses:
Your lawyer will certainly discuss their cost framework and any type of involved legal costs throughout the preliminary assessment. This is an important discussion to have in advance to guarantee you understand the financial effects of hiring lawful depiction. They might additionally review payment plans or alternatives for funding legal costs.

6. Privacy and Attorney-Client Privilege:
Your lawyer will certainly highlight the relevance of privacy and attorney-client privilege. They will clarify that anything you review throughout the consultation is shielded by law and will certainly not be shown any person without your permission. This is essential for developing depend on and making certain open interaction throughout your case.

7. Next Steps:
At the end of the consultation, your lawyer will certainly describe the following steps in the legal process. This might include collecting additional proof, filing motions, working out with the prosecution, or planning for trial. They will certainly provide you with a clear timeline and keep you notified concerning any kind of essential advancements in your case.

Exploring Defense Methods and Lawful Choices



As soon as all the necessary info has been collected and reviewed, it's time to delve into the world of protection strategies and explore the different lawful options offered to you. Your criminal defense attorney will certainly lead you through this vital action, guaranteeing that you understand the possible paths your case might take. Below are three key factors to take into consideration throughout this process:

- ** Crafting a solid protection: ** Your attorney will carefully assess the evidence against you and develop a protection technique customized to your certain situations. They will explore every possible angle to challenge the prosecution's case and shield your civil liberties.


- ** Working out plea deals: ** Depending on the conditions, your lawyer may discover the choice of negotiating a plea deal with the prosecution. This can possibly lead to lowered fees or penalties, supplying a beneficial result for you.

- ** Exploring different resolutions: ** Your lawyer will additionally discover different resolutions, such as diversion programs or recovery options, if they think it may be beneficial to your case. These choices can supply a possibility at recovery instead of imprisonment.

Bear in mind, your criminal defense lawyer is your supporter and will function relentlessly to defend your rights and interests throughout the legal process.
